Abstract

A sensitive and accurate indirect spectroscopic method has been proposed for the determination of furosemide in acidic media. The method includes oxidation of safranin dye in the presence of N-bromosuccinimide as an oxidizing agent to form a pink-colored product that can be measured spectrophotometrically at a wavelength of 526 nm. The molar absorbance and Sandel sensitivity were (2.4×104 L/mol.cm) and (0.0135 µg\cm) respectively, the correlation coefficient was 0.9995 with a recovery rate of 97.24%, a standard deviation of 0.867%, 0.0966 µg\ml for (LOD) and 0.322 µg\ml for (LOQ). The technique was applied to determine the purity of furosemide and the medicinal forms of it.
